## Changelog — vaultcycle 3.2

Heads up, plugin authors: we changed some defaults in vaultcycle, our secrets-rotation tool. Rotation interval dropped from 30 days to 7, and the overlap window where old and new secrets both validate is now 48 hours instead of 24. If your plugin caches credentials longer than that, you'll start seeing auth failures. Grace-period callbacks now fire twice. The new shipped defaults are shown in full below.

service settings:
[casax]
port = 6379
team = rusir
host = casax.zemvarhq.corp
region = outer-4
access_code = ac_9808ce
timeout_ms = 1500

**Bloom filter layer — Pellgrove KV.** All reads to the Thornett store pass through a bloom filter to skip disk lookups for absent keys. False positives are possible; false negatives are not. Filter bits are rebuilt nightly from the authoritative keyset. No key material is stored in the filter itself. Threat model notes and rebuild-job permissions are documented on the internal page here.

wiki page, tahaf-tajog: https://jira.ordindyn.corp/pipeline

**Action Item 3 — Diff viewer OOM on large files.** Owner: on-call. The Splitpane diff viewer loaded full file contents into memory; a 2GB artifact took down two workers. Mitigation shipped: chunked diffing with a hard 50MB cap. Remaining work: add an alert on diff-memory usage and verify the cap holds under concurrent load. If the alert fires, follow the degrade-to-summary procedure documented on the internal page below.

wiki page, bagaf-fawip: https://harbor.tolvaqsys.local/pages/repo/pages/secrets/eac969ffc71f356b

## Authentication

Heads up: the nightly reindex job (`reindex_nightly.py`) talks to the Lanternfish search cluster, and that cluster won't accept anonymous writes anymore — we locked it down last sprint. The job now authenticates as the `reindex-runner` service identity against Corvid Gateway, and the token is injected via the `LF_INDEX_TOKEN` env var in the scheduler config. Nothing clever going on, just a bearer header on every batch request. For review purposes, the staging credential currently in use is listed below.

service key, kadug-kadup: kto15_rN23XLAYImmZgrJ